Newsmaker: Kathleen K. McKenzie

Noteworthy: The Carnegie Science Center added McKenzie to its board of directors.

Age: 52

Family: Husband Glenn, daughters Lauren and Clare

Residence: Point Breeze

Occupation: McKenzie is vice president of community and civic affairs at Allegheny Health Network. Before that, she served in high-ranking city and county positions, including as Allegheny County's deputy manager and as a human resources manager for Pittsburgh. She also worked in private practice as a lawyer for 10 years.

Education: McKenzie earned a bachelor's degree in government from Lafayette College and a law degree from the University of Pittsburgh School of Law.

Quote: “Carnegie Science Center and Highmark SportsWorks have special places in my life as a Pittsburgh parent. From the many birthday parties we attended to the ‘day at the Science Center' visits with my daughters, the experiences enriched our lives and sparked an interest in science we share as a family together. I'm proud to join a board whose mission it is to continue to make science accessible to all.”
